What's the 2004 Nissan Armada fuel pump relay location?

The fuel pump relay on the 2004 Nissan Armada is integrated into the IPDM, which stands for intelligent power distribution module. The relay is not serviceable and if You experience any issues with it You must replace the entire IPDM, at a cost of around $100 to $150 just for the parts. The IPDM is located on the passenger side of the engine compartment bolted to the firewall. It is possible with the right know how and equipment to replace the relay, although it is not recommended. The IPDM would need to be removed from the vehicle and taken apart to gain access to this circuitry inside of it. Once the relay is located it has to be carefully desoldered from the board.
